Course Details
- Introduction to Reverse Logistics: Understanding the basics, principles, and benefits of reverse logistics in supply chain management.
- Returns Management: Processes and strategies for handling returns, including order cancellation, exchange, and refund.
- Inventory Management in Reverse Logistics: Techniques and best practices for managing returned inventory, including inspection, grading, and disposal.
- Transportation and Distribution in Reverse Logistics: Strategies for efficient and cost-effective transportation and distribution of returned products, including consolidation and mode selection.
- Sustainability in Reverse Logistics: Practices and technologies to minimize environmental impact, reduce waste, and promote sustainability.
- Legal and Compliance Issues in Reverse Logistics: Understanding legal and regulatory requirements, such as data privacy, product safety, and disposal regulations.
- Customer Service and Reverse Logistics: Strategies for providing excellent customer service during the returns process, including communication, problem resolution, and satisfaction measurement.
- Technology and Reverse Logistics: Overview of technology solutions for reverse logistics, including software, automation, and data analytics.
- Performance Metrics and Analytics in Reverse Logistics: Techniques for measuring and improving reverse logistics performance, including key performance indicators (KPIs), benchmarking, and continuous improvement.
Career Path
The reverse logistics sector offers a variety of roles and opportunities for career advancement in the UK.
With the increasing focus on sustainability and the efficient management of returns, these positions are in high demand.
Here's a look at some popular roles and their market share in the reverse logistics returns fulfillment sector: 1. Returns Process Coordinator: Efficiently managing and coordinating return processes is essential for any logistics operation.
These professionals handle returns, exchanges, and warranty claims, ensuring customer satisfaction and cost optimization. 2. Quality Assurance Analyst: Ensuring the quality of returned items and determining their fate (repair, refurbish, or dispose) is a critical role in reverse logistics.
Quality assurance analysts help maintain brand reputation and reduce costs associated with returns. 3. Inventory Control Specialist: Professionals in this role manage inventory levels, ensuring that returned items are correctly accounted for and available for resale or disposal.
They work closely with other logistics team members to maintain optimal stock levels. 4. Supply Chain Analyst: Analyzing the supply chain and identifying areas for improvement is a vital function in reverse logistics.
Supply chain analysts help streamline processes, reduce costs, and enhance the overall efficiency of returns management. 5. Reverse Logistics Manager: Overseeing the entire returns process, reverse logistics managers are responsible for developing and implementing strategies that minimize costs and maximize value from returned items.
They work closely with other departments to ensure seamless integration with the forward logistics process. 6. Sustainability Coordinator: With growing concerns about the environmental impact of returns, sustainability coordinators play a crucial role in developing and implementing eco-friendly strategies for managing returned items.
They help minimize waste, reduce carbon emissions, and promote a circular economy within the organization.
